Key Facts

  • trichloroacetyl chloride's instance of is recorded as type of chemical entity[3].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's chemical structure is recorded as Trichloroacetyl chloride.svg[4].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's CAS Registry Number is recorded as 76-02-8[5].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's EC number is recorded as 200-926-7[6].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's canonical SMILES is recorded as C(=O)(C(Cl)(Cl)Cl)Cl[7].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's InChI is recorded as InChI=1S/C2Cl4O/c3-1(7)2(4,5)6[8].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's InChIKey is recorded as PVFOMCVHYWHZJE-UHFFFAOYSA-N[9].
  • trichloroacetyl chloride's chemical formula is recorded as C₂Cl₄O[10].
